| Hecke algebras and class-group invariant Let $G$ be a finite group. To a set of subgroups of order two we associate
a $\mod 2$ Hecke algebra and construct a homomorphism, $\psi$, from its
units to the class-group of ${\bf Z}[G]$. We show that this homomorphism
takes values in the subgroup, $D({\bf Z}[G])$. Alternative constructions of
Chinburg invariants arising from the Galois module structure of
higher-dimensional algebraic $K$-groups of rings of algebraic integers
often differ by elements in the image of $\psi$. As an application we show
that two such constructions coincide.
